Owner report 11618791 · 2024-10-08 (October 8, 2024)

The Balmar alternator is going bad on my 2023 transit on my 2024 Winnebago Ekko. It is starting to whine which in the past leads to a fire in the engine compartment on others units. It is recommended to pull the 4 wire plug that goes Balmar regulator in the lithonics battery compartment, which I did to prevent any additional damage. So without the Balmar unit the batteries will only charge plugged into shore power. A Winnebago group recommended reporting this problem to NHTSA Thank you.

Owner report 11621634 · 2024-10-23 (October 23, 2024)

The A/C on our 24E/24T EKKO stopped working today, October 13, on old Route 66 in Oklahoma. The ICM870-16A-BH5400 easy start circuit board was fried. A portion of the circuit board had melted and the brown wire was loose and the connector melted. The ICM cover fell loose when I removed the GE A/C cover. See the attached photos. The ICM870-16A-BH5400 is included in GE Kit GEASST-1. The BH5400 suffix is unique to the GE sourced easy start. Owner report 11757112 · 2026-08-15 (August 15, 2026)

Brakes went out while driving on 77n. In viginia. Once we were anle to get to the side of the road realized we were on fire. Ford dealership determined the fire burnt the brake lines boiling fluid pushing it back through master cylinder knocking out my brakes.
